Job Description

You will be responsible for managing the Medical Equipment portfolio across Italy, Greece, Malta and Cyprus. You will support daily marketing activities for key product lines (e.g., diagnostic cardiology, low‑acuity vitals, surgical solutions, patient support systems), ensuring alignment with strategy and business goals. Acts as the Italian marketing team coordinator and key reference for product launches, campaigns and portfolio communication.

Job Responsibility

  • Develop annual portfolio plans and manage product launches
  • Track business performance and identify improvement opportunities
  • Execute marketing programs, promotions, digital campaigns and pricing initiatives
  • Manage marketing budget and promotional activities
  • Collaborate with sales teams to ensure alignment on marketing initiatives
  • Coordinate company presence at conferences and exhibitions
  • Lead internal and external portfolio communication with support from Communications
  • Work with European Marketing for alignment and resource sharing
  • Support training development and market research activities
  • Monitor competition and communicate insights effectively
  • Act as the point of contact for portfolio updates and promotions
  • Oversee demo product management and provide guidance to junior marketing staff

Requirements

  • Strong digital skills
  • digital marketing experience is a plus
  • Innovative mindset and ability to think creatively
  • Excellent interpersonal and customer‑oriented skills
  • Understanding of hospital dynamics and capital equipment processes
  • Comfortable working in fast‑paced environments
  • Fluent in Italian and English
  • 4+ years of marketing experience in medical devices or pharmaceuticals
  • sales experience is a plus
  • Degree in marketing, clinical sciences or engineering (or similar background)
